You might not be a game creator, graphic designer an architect, or an engineer and possibly just beginning your online and computer experience. So if you are new to the world of modeling rendering, custom modeling rendering options might seem complicated to begin with.
It’s best to begin with the understanding that the type of modeling rendering software you pick will highly depend on what you want your end result to be.
Let’s take a look at architectural rendering. Architectural rendering is done with special software which gives an attention to shading, texture, perspective, and realism. Real life objects could even be modeled using the appropriate software program and even achieve photorealistic effects found in artwork, landscaping, engineering or other software programs.
On the other hand, something like game object rendering may differ from architectural rendering. The idea is to convey the idea of motion and effects at about 30 frames per second and less emphasis is placed on detail compared to camera effects.
If none of this confuses you, then perhaps a specialized custom modeling rendering software may actually work for you. Of course, you need adequate time and a fair degree of determination. Finally, picking a software program is based upon the results you seek. Another factor in choosing software would be the the need for real-time modeling rendering versus non-real-time or more detailed rendering.
In the event you still don’t feel like you haven’t reached an understanding of the idea of modeling rendering or trying it yourself, you can find custom rendering services available. Interestingly, or not, these are not simply used by the non professional graphics artists and creative individuals, but by professionals as well who may already have the software and skills but feel their time is better spent on the creative end as opposed to modeling rendering. The thing to consider here is time versus results.
Just like any service, you need to ensure it is reputable before choosing to use it. Consider looking at their previous work to determine if they will be right for you. Quality custom rendering services want you to contact them and therefore will make sure that their contact information is accessible. Such highly regarded businesses and organizations providing these kinds of expert services will be genuinely helpful in answering any questions, and also producing quotes.
If you’re thinking about seeking a custom modeling rendering, then be specific with your request: specify what you need it for, what delivery format it needs to be in, and provide lots of photos if requested or drawings. The more specific you are within your request and the more information you give, the more likely you’ll be happy with the outcome as well as the product ordered.
Modeling rendering doesn’t have to be special ordered if you know what you need and a rendering service offers pre-made models. Sometimes, rendering services will have ready-made exclusive and non exclusive 3D rendering models on hand. The benefit to these is their delivery is significantly faster than a custom modeling rendering.
You’ll want to understand the differences between exclusive and non exclusive objects before you order. Exclusive means the product is sold only once and no one else will have the opportunity to purchase that exact same model, while non exclusive is offered usually at a lower price but might be sold repeatedly. Either type has its own advantages and drawbacks so fully understand what you need beforehand. Moreover, various rendering services will customize premade objects for a fee.

Any one that relishes art and loves cartoons would most probably be fascinated with animation and find computer animation enchanting. Animation came alive with 2D animation then moved on into 3D, which has now become the way of the animation world. It would never have evolved to this point without the success of the 2D. In fact, its still dependent on the skills essential for 2D to be utilised to 3D animation. So, where you hear somebody say the 2D animation is mundane then do not give it a second thought.
In modern technology where almost anybody is on pcs at numerous point of time its unlikely they would not be open to a few type of animation . It must not be forgotten that animation is not simply restricted to cartoon characters.
To put it simply whatever moving picture that has been made to do so by the computer is computer animation. The technique utilized is a way to produce the illusion of movement one picture on the screen promptly is substituted by some other one thats nearly identical to the first one but not exact. It occurs the identical way with some other media like television and movies. Most frequently, this’s accomplished with 3D computer graphics and the outcomes are directed to the computer, but it could be for movies as well. You may hear this referred to as CGI signifying computer generated imagery.
Computer animation is simply some other method of creating animation by way of automation or computer technology. The principals are identical as when they’re done by hand, its merely the computer is able to do much of the preparation work and interpreting of the finished version. It duplicates the stop motion techniques of 3D and framing by 2D.
Using the comp for animation is a systematic procedure. To begin with, the object is built on the comp monitor. These’re the models. And then the 3D figures have to have a virtual skeleton. To get the major movements example for the eyes, mouth or clothing for illustration then the comp would create an action named tweening or morphing.
When dealing with 3D animations it’s important to bear in mind that all of the comparable fundamentals and basics of animation are utilised. In this case, though modeling must be complete prior to rendering. The rendering in tweened frame is done as needed.
As you can see with 3D animation, the majority of the work is finished through the comp. Even though the computer does the work it has to have the instructions to do so, and that’s where the 3D animators job comes in. This means besides the fundamentals keen comp skills and a thorough knowledge of the capabilities of the software are a requirement.

You perhaps have heard about CAD rendering, and additionally if you’re not a graphics designer you might not be aware of exactly how frequently or where it is used. You might be surprised just how often and in which applications CAD rendering appears.
Architectural rendering is not merely just for architects irrespective of its name. Automobile manufacturers, landscapers, engineers and others work with CAD rendering or have it completed for them. It allows them to find faults throughout the design and perspective well before downright costly problems are made in real time production.
Architectural rendering ıs extremely detailed oriented and includes realistic lighting as well as textures to give a much more natural look and feel to the modeled object. A virtual walk through is often created for the web to give potential buyers an authentic feel for the design. Automobile designers are giving life to their models in 3D prior to production with the aid of architectural rendering.
CAD, known as Computer Aided Design, may be as simple as the 2D representation with very little detail or realism to being complicated and also adaptable as 3D parametric solid modeling. It will depend on the use the final product will be put to, in addition to the ability of the CAD operator. The simplest are 2D or wire models.
There are numerous types of CAD applications readily available. They range in cost from freeware (high learning curves with low end simplified outcomes), all the way to more expensive software applications complete with advanced engines that will actually take a design from the drawing board and bring it to life. Although, the higher priced software programs might also have higher learning curves because of all of the options as well as details that can be imported.
If you’re a designer you might not necessarily be considered a software genius. CAD software takes some skill and usually either schooling or several of trial and error. Architectural rendering or CAD may be outsourced and sometimes this is the wisest choice in terms of time and cost.
If the possibility of a rendering service appeal to your situation as well as to your budget, then it is essential for you to view examples of their work, ask about their delivery time, in addition to balance costs. Always pick a reliable service and be mindful of any that promise way too low a price or only offer stock rendering. Outstanding services will get as much details as possible before providing a price. Beware of any that offer a custom architectural rendering service for a flat fee or if the costs seem way too low. Regarding architectural rendering like with anything else, you usually get what you purchase.
Should you choose to figure out how to use Architectural rendering programs then schedule sufficient time when considering the learning curve. Invest time into discovering tutorials that may shorten the training time. Ensure that your software is suitable for any use you intend to put it through and lay in a good stock of patience.

Apple today released the first quarter of fiscal year 2010 financial results. The report shows that due to sales of Mac computers and iPhone are a record, Apple in the first quarter gross margin is much higher than expected net profit and revenue for the year to promote its big Increase growth.
Ended December 26, 2009 in this quarter, Apple’s net profit was 33.8 billion U.S. dollars, 3.67 U.S. dollars per diluted share, this performance better than last year over the same period. The first quarter of fiscal 2009, Apple’s net profit of 2.26 billion U.S. dollars, 2.50 U.S. dollars per diluted share. Apple’s first-quarter operating profit of 4.725 billion U.S. dollars. Apple’s first-quarter revenues of 15.68 billion U.S. dollars, higher than last year’s 11.88 billion U.S. dollars, of which the proportion of international sales To 58%. Apple’s first quarter gross margin was 40.9%, up from 37.9% a year earlier, exceeding Wall Street analyst consensus expectations of 35.8%.
The first quarter Apple sold 3.36 million units Mac, compared with same period last year, up 33%, above the average analyst expectations of about 300 million units; sold 21 million iPod, down 8% compared with same period last year; sold a total of 870 10000 iPhone, 100% over last year, slightly lower than analyst expectations of 900 million units.
Apple CEO SteveJobs said: “If our quarterly revenue converted by year, then will be surprised to find that Apple is now an annual revenue of more than 50 billion U.S. dollars of the company. This year, we plan to release the New products is very strong, this week will be the first to release a major new product, we are very excited about this new product. ”
Apple Chief Financial Officer PeterOppenheimer, said: “We are in the first quarter, generated 58 million in cash, am very happy. We expect the second quarter of fiscal year 2010 revenues of approximately 11,000,000,000-11,400,000,000 dollars, diluted earnings per share of about 2.06 to 2.18 U.S. dollars. “Wall Street analysts had expected, Apple’s fourth-quarter revenue of 9.1 billion, diluted earnings per share 1.30 U.S. dollars.
The same day, Apple shares on the Nasdaq rose 5.32 U.S. dollars in regular trading, to close at 203.07 U.S. dollars, or 2.69%. In the ensuing at 16:30 U.S. Eastern Time and ending after-hours trading, Apple shares rise again 1.28 U.S. dollars, or 0.63%. Over the past 52 weeks, Apple’s stock price to 215.59 U.S. dollars a maximum, the minimum share price of 82.33 U.S. dollars.
